Quantum computing is making progress in various ways. One evidence of its progress is the development of more powerful quantum processors. For example, the D-Wave qubit processor is capable of encoding information in quantum bits (qubits) to perform complex calculations. Another proof of progress is the increasing understanding of quantum mechanics and the ability to manipulate and control qubits effectively, leading to advancements in quantum algorithms and applications. Additionally, the potential of quantum computers to solve complex problems more efficiently than classical computers is demonstrated through research and experiments.
